Add emulation of the PowerPC Round to DFP Short (drsp[.]) and Round to DFP Long (drdpq[.]) instructions.
Signed-off-by: Tom Musta <tommu...@gmail.com> --- target-ppc/dfp_helper.c | 52 +++++++++++++++++++++++++++++++++++++++++++++++ target-ppc/helper.h | 2 + target-ppc/translate.c | 4 +++ 3 files changed, 58 insertions(+), 0 deletions(-) diff --git a/target-ppc/dfp_helper.c b/target-ppc/dfp_helper.c index a719797..25afaba 100644 --- a/target-ppc/dfp_helper.c +++ b/target-ppc/dfp_helper.c @@ -249,6 +249,20 @@ static void dfp_set_FPRF_from_FRT(struct PPC_DFP *dfp) dfp_set_FPRF_from_FRT_with_context(dfp, &dfp->context); } +static void dfp_set_FPRF_from_FRT_short(struct PPC_DFP *dfp) +{ + decContext shortContext; + decContextDefault(&shortContext, DEC_INIT_DECIMAL32); + dfp_set_FPRF_from_FRT_with_context(dfp, &shortContext); +} + +static void dfp_set_FPRF_from_FRT_long(struct PPC_DFP *dfp) +{ + decContext longContext; + decContextDefault(&longContext, DEC_INIT_DECIMAL64); + dfp_set_FPRF_from_FRT_with_context(dfp, &longContext); +} + static void dfp_check_for_OX(struct PPC_DFP *dfp) { if (dfp->context.status & DEC_Overflow) { @@ -880,3 +894,41 @@ void helper_dctqpq(CPUPPCState *env, uint64_t *t, uint64_t *b) t[0] = dfp.t64[HI_IDX]; t[1] = dfp.t64[LO_IDX]; } + +PPC_DFP_PostProc RSP_PPs[] = { + dfp_set_FPRF_from_FRT_short, + dfp_check_for_OX, + dfp_check_for_UX, + dfp_check_for_XX, +}; + +void helper_drsp(CPUPPCState *env, uint64_t *t, uint64_t *b) +{ + struct PPC_DFP dfp; + uint32_t t_short = 0; + dfp_prepare_decimal64(&dfp, 0, b, env); + decimal32FromNumber((decimal32 *)&t_short, &dfp.b, &dfp.context); + decimal32ToNumber((decimal32 *)&t_short, &dfp.t); + dfp_run_post_processors(&dfp, RSP_PPs, ARRAY_SIZE(RSP_PPs)); + *t = t_short; +} + +PPC_DFP_PostProc RDPQ_PPs[] = { + dfp_check_for_VXSNAN_and_convert_to_QNaN, + dfp_set_FPRF_from_FRT_long, + dfp_check_for_OX, + dfp_check_for_UX, + dfp_check_for_XX, +}; + +void helper_drdpq(CPUPPCState *env, uint64_t *t, uint64_t *b) +{ + struct PPC_DFP dfp; + dfp_prepare_decimal128(&dfp, 0, b, env); + decimal64FromNumber((decimal64 *)&dfp.t64, &dfp.b, &dfp.context); + decimal64ToNumber((decimal64 *)&dfp.t64, &dfp.t); + dfp_run_post_processors(&dfp, RDPQ_PPs, ARRAY_SIZE(RDPQ_PPs)); + decimal64FromNumber((decimal64 *)dfp.t64, &dfp.t, &dfp.context); + t[0] = dfp.t64[0]; + t[1] = 0; +} diff --git a/target-ppc/helper.h b/target-ppc/helper.h index a99ca1c..d9ef8f6 100644 --- a/target-ppc/helper.h +++ b/target-ppc/helper.h @@ -650,4 +650,6 @@ DEF_HELPER_5(drintn, void, env, fprp, fprp, i32, i32) DEF_HELPER_5(drintnq, void, env, fprp, fprp, i32, i32) DEF_HELPER_3(dctdp, void, env, fprp, fprp) DEF_HELPER_3(dctqpq, void, env, fprp, fprp) +DEF_HELPER_3(drsp, void, env, fprp, fprp) +DEF_HELPER_3(drdpq, void, env, fprp, fprp) #include "exec/def-helper.h" diff --git a/target-ppc/translate.c b/target-ppc/translate.c index da70c8d..391f55d 100644 --- a/target-ppc/translate.c +++ b/target-ppc/translate.c @@ -8388,6 +8388,8 @@ GEN_DFP_T_B_U32_U32_Rc(drintn, FPW, RMC) GEN_DFP_T_B_U32_U32_Rc(drintnq, FPW, RMC) GEN_DFP_T_B_Rc(dctdp) GEN_DFP_T_B_Rc(dctqpq) +GEN_DFP_T_B_Rc(drsp) +GEN_DFP_T_B_Rc(drdpq) /*** SPE extension ***/ /* Register moves */ @@ -11347,6 +11349,8 @@ GEN_DFP_R_T_B_RMC_Rc(drintn, 0x03, 0x07), GEN_DFP_R_Tp_Bp_RMC_Rc(drintnq, 0x03, 0x07), GEN_DFP_T_B_Rc(dctdp, 0x02, 0x08), GEN_DFP_Tp_B_Rc(dctqpq, 0x02, 0x08), +GEN_DFP_T_B_Rc(drsp, 0x02, 0x18), +GEN_DFP_Tp_Bp_Rc(drdpq, 0x02, 0x18), #undef GEN_SPE #define GEN_SPE(name0, name1, opc2, opc3, inval0, inval1, type) \ GEN_OPCODE_DUAL(name0##_##name1, 0x04, opc2, opc3, inval0, inval1, type, PPC_NONE) -- 1.7.1
